Rating Update Context

On 01 June 2026, MarketsMOJO revised Bhartiya International Ltd's rating from 'Strong Sell' to 'Sell', reflecting a modest improvement in the company's overall assessment. The Mojo Score increased by 9 points, moving from 28 to 37, signalling a slight enhancement in certain performance parameters. Despite this, the rating remains firmly in the sell category, underscoring ongoing concerns about the company's financial health and market position.

Here's How the Stock Looks Today

As of 16 July 2026, Bhartiya International Ltd is classified as a microcap company operating within the diversified consumer products sector. The stock's recent price movements show a 1-day gain of 2.81%, a 1-month increase of 3.51%, and a 6-month rise of 9.70%. However, the 1-year return stands at -13.60%, indicating significant underperformance relative to the broader market, where the BSE500 index declined by only -1.23% over the same period.

Quality Assessment

The company’s quality grade is rated as average. This reflects a middling level of operational efficiency and profitability. Bhartiya International Ltd has demonstrated limited ability to generate strong returns on equity, with an average Return on Equity (ROE) of 4.49%. This figure suggests that the company is generating modest profits relative to shareholders’ funds, which may not be sufficient to attract investors seeking robust growth or income.

Financial Trend Analysis

The financial trend for Bhartiya International Ltd is flat, signalling stagnation in key financial metrics. The latest quarterly results ending March 2026 reveal a sharp decline in profitability, with a net loss after tax (PAT) of ₹8.78 crores, representing a fall of 158.8% compared to previous periods. Profit before tax excluding other income (PBT less OI) also hit a low of ₹-6.72 crores, while earnings per share (EPS) dropped to ₹-6.55. These figures highlight the company’s current struggles to generate positive earnings and maintain financial momentum.

Debt and Liquidity Considerations

Bhartiya International Ltd faces challenges in servicing its debt obligations, as evidenced by a high Debt to EBITDA ratio of 4.51 times. This elevated leverage ratio points to a significant debt burden relative to earnings before interest, taxes, depreciation, and amortisation, raising concerns about the company’s financial flexibility and risk profile. Such a position may constrain the company’s ability to invest in growth initiatives or weather adverse market conditions.

Market Participation and Investor Interest

Notably, domestic mutual funds currently hold no stake in Bhartiya International Ltd. Given that mutual funds typically conduct thorough research and due diligence before investing, their absence may reflect reservations about the company’s valuation, business model, or growth prospects. This lack of institutional interest can contribute to lower liquidity and higher volatility in the stock.
